Recognizing a Dental Emergency
Determining what qualifies as a dental emergency can be tricky when you’re dealing with pain and stress. A dental emergency involves any situation where immediate dental care is needed to save a tooth, stop bleeding, or alleviate severe pain. Common signs include intense pain that doesn’t respond to over-the-counter medication, swelling that affects your ability to swallow, trauma that results in loose or knocked-out teeth, and bleeding that won’t stop. If you’re questioning whether your situation requires emergency dental care services, it’s always better to call and ask rather than wait and risk permanent damage.

The Most Common Dental Emergencies We See
Dental emergencies are more common than you might think, and some issues occur more frequently than others. Here are the most common dental emergencies we see and why they require immediate attention:
- Severe toothaches: Often caused by deep decay or infection that needs urgent care
- Knocked-out teeth: With sports injuries or accidents, prompt treatment is crucial to save the tooth
- Cracked or broken teeth: Caused by biting hard objects or falls, exposing sensitive inner tooth structures and causing discomfort
- Abscesses and infections: Can spread quickly and cause serious health risks if untreated
- Lost fillings or crowns: Leaves teeth vulnerable and often causes sharp pain with temperature changes or pressure
Why Immediate Care Makes All the Difference
Seeking prompt emergency dental care services offers several crucial benefits that can save your teeth and prevent complications. Quick treatment often means the difference between saving a tooth and needing extraction or replacement. Early intervention can prevent infections from spreading to other teeth or your bloodstream, which can become life-threatening. Immediate pain relief allows you to return to your normal activities and get the rest you need to heal properly. Professional emergency care also prevents you from inadvertently making the problem worse by attempting home remedies that might seem helpful but actually cause additional damage.

How do I know if I need emergency dental care?
Severe pain that interferes with eating, sleeping, or daily activities requires immediate attention. Trauma to your mouth, loose or knocked-out teeth, and signs of infection like swelling or fever also warrant emergency treatment.
Can emergency dental services save a knocked-out tooth?
Yes, if you act quickly. Keep the tooth moist, handle it by the crown (not the root), and get to our office within an hour for the best chance of successful reimplantation.
What should I do if a filling or crown falls out?
Save the crown if possible and call us immediately. Avoid chewing on that side of your mouth and use temporary dental cement from a pharmacy if needed until you can see us.
